When "wu-yi tea" is typed into a search engine, folks may take notice the ads that pop up along the side of the screen, some of which seem to be hyping this product. Some claim that this tea will dramatically make you lose weight, and all you have to do is drink 3 or 4 cups a day, and you'll burn off fat faster than you can count calories. Well, at least that is the message some are betraying.


The truth is, this variety of tea can indeed help you lose weight, but "help" is the keyword. Proper dieting and exercise are other important key factors on weight loss. Please do not misunderstand that wu-yi tea will do it all by itself. Also, it is recommended that you seek your doctor's advice before consuming any tea for weight loss…

So What Exactly Is Wu-yi Tea?

wu-yi teaWu-yi, is a variety of Chinese oolong tea that is grown in the Wuyi mountains located in the north-western part of China in the Fujian Province. There really isn't nothing special about these teas save the fact that they will brew a distinctive and flavorsome cup. Also, there are several different varieties of wuyi tea. Generally, the brew from each produces a cup that is full-bodied, with a slight flowery sweetness containing medium vegetal undertones. Chinese oolong teas can also taste "woody" depending on the oxidation which can vary between 30 to 70 percent.

Another fact to state is that all oolong tea is cultivated from the same species of plant, the Camellia sinensis. So when you think about it, ALL oolong teas contain the same benefits, although their taste can differ; which directs us back to the hype topic.

The reason this variety of tea is getting this weight loss attention is because oolong tea in general contain a higher plant polyphenol count over the other three main classes of tea, green, white, and black tea.

Polyphenols are substances in tea that when consumed trigger an action in the body called "thermogenesis". To simplify, this stimulates enzymes in the body which burn off calories by dissolving fatty tissues called triglyceride; all this when combined with exercise and proper eating can equal weight loss. Since all oolong teas have these high polyphenol properties, ALL oolong teas can aid in shedding pounds; wuyi varieties are no different! Granted they might contain just a tad bit more, but the difference in actual results is not going to be night and day.

Besides weight loss benefits, other advantages of drinking several cups of oolong tea daily are:
  1. Oolong helps lower blood pressure and bad cholesterol levels
  2. Destroys free radicals which damage the skin and increase the aging process
  3. Helps prevent certain tumors and cancers from developing
  4. Boosts the immune system and helps fight off viruses
  5. Destroys bacteria in the mouth that cause oral diseases like gingivitis
  6. Provides folks with more natural energy and has low caffeine levels
This beverage is enjoyed by many who fancy its flavor, history, vast varieties and culture. Weight loss is just one of many reasons people should get into the healthy habit of drinking it.
